Lot 3485
FRANCE, Renaissance Medals. Marie de' Medici, 1575-1642. Medal (Bronze, 52 mm, 58.45 g, 7 h), in the style of Guillaume Dupré (1574-1647). A later aftercast, no date. MARIA AVG.GALL.ET.NAVAR. REGIN (retrograde) Draped bust of Queen consort Maria de' Medici wearing widow's cap with elaborate collar to right. Rev. LÆTA DEVM PARTV Marie as Cybele surrounded by her children, to left Louis XIII (as Jupiter) Henritte Marie (as Venus) to right Christine (as Diana) and Elizabeth (as Juno). Bernhart p. 33. Cf. Jones II 100, 61 (in silver). Mazerolle 694. Tiny scratches and edge nicks, otherwise, about very fine.
